WebNov 16, 2024 · Acquired thrombotic thrombocytopenic purpura (aTTP) is a rare disease with an incidence of 3–10 cases per million adults per year. The disease is defined by a severe reduction in the activity of von Willebrand factor-cleaving protease ADAMTS 13, which is mainly caused by the presence of inhibitory antibodies. ... WebApr 30, 2024 · The most common (≥ 5% incidence) bleeding-related TEAEs were epistaxis (27 vs 3%), gingival bleeding (17 vs 1%), contusion (7 vs 14%) and catheter site haemorrhage (7 vs 7%). The majority of bleeding-related TEAEs were of mild or moderate severity, and most did not require therapeutic intervention [ 19 ]. WebJul 7, 2024 · In 76.7% of the cases (46 of 60 patients), aTTP was considered a primary manifestation when presented with a disease relapse (23.3%; 14 of 60 patients). An initial ADAMTS13 activity of <10% was reported in all patients (median <0.3%; range, 0% to 8.0%). The median initial thrombocyte count was 13 × 10 9 /L (range, 3-82 × 10 9 /L).
